About Bernhard Botters
Bernhard Botters is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 10 papers that have together received 521 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Magnetic properties of thin films (8 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(6 papers), Theoretical and Computational Physics (3 papers),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(2 papers),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(1 paper), Photonic and Optical Devices (1 paper), Molecular Junctions and Nanostructures (1 paper) and Wireless Power Transfer Systems (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(289 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(416 citations) and Condensed Matter Physics (149 citations). Bernhard Botters has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Italy and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Dirk Grundler, S. Neusser, F. Giesen, Jan Podbielski, M. Madami, G. Carlotti, A. O. Adeyeye, G. Gubbiotti, S. Tacchi and D. Schmitt‐Landsiedel.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review B, Applied Physics Letters, IEEE Transactions on Magnetics, Solid State Communications and The Journal of Chemical Physics.
